Help get children reading with this charming alternative fairy tale.
Little Wolf doesn't want to be like the bad wolves in his storybooks.
So off he trots into the woods where he tries to be good. But every
time Little Wolf helps, everyone gets angry! Will Little Wolf ever be a
hero? And will anyone ever write a story about a good little wolf?
This quirky adventure from author A.H. Benjamin is perfect for children
who are learning to read by themselves and for Key Stage 1. It features
engaging illustrations from Sarah Aspinall and a relatable hero young
readers will find hard to resist.
